There are a number of factors that influence the cost of replacing the suzuki car key. One of the most important is the kind of key you have. Suzuki keys include a transponder chip that requires programming to match the code your vehicle's immobiliser system anticipates.

You should inform your locksmith about the specific model of your vehicle and the type of key you own. This will allow them to prepare themselves ahead of time.

1. The kind of key

The kind of key you lost is one of the main factors that will affect how much it costs to replace it. There are many types, including smart keys fob remote "push to start" keys, as well as regular "non-transponder" keys. The locksmith you inform about the type of key you have will help him figure out what price to charge to replace it.

young-couple-holding-the-keys-of-a-new-car-select-2023-04-03-23-35-08-utc-scaled.jpgThe "push-to-start" fob remote keys for cars have buttons that can be used to unlock and start the car from a distance. The keys contain a microchip inside that contains an informational code that the vehicle's ECU expects to receive when the key is placed in the ignition barrel. The engine will not start when the code on the chip doesn't match. These keys generally cost more than the standard non-transponder automobile keys.

Suzuki car keys are not sold at a price that is set. The price is determined by a variety aspects, including the type of key and whether it needs to be programmed.

You can have your suzuki replacement key fob car key changed at a dealer, however they may charge more than an automotive locksmith. This is due to dealers having only a limited number of codes that they can cut replacement keys. They may also not be able cut a key for older models.
